Abstract:Lump sum agreements have been widely and frequently employed in the practice of internation-al claims arising out of expropriation and nationalization on a large scale of property of aliens. The com-monprovisions lieinthis typeofclaims agreement providingpaymentbyrespondentstateof afixedsumof compensation to claimant state,eligibility of claimants,compensable claims,sole responsibility on the claimant state to distribute the compensation funds,waiver by claimant statetobringanyfurther claima-gainstrespondentstate,etc. Afterwards,thestateauthorityoftheclaimantstatewillbeinchargeofadju-dicatingclaimsbroughtbyitsnationals. Addressed here are some legal aspectsoftheabove-mentioned statepractices,includingclaims byandagainst China bothas claimantstateandrespondentstate respec-tively. With the increasing scal eofdirectinves tment in and from China,suchdisputesettlementmethod mightbe of help in protecting China's national interests,including overseas interests.
